Psy-Op Strain Overview

Psy-Op is a relatively modern hybrid cannabis strain that has gained attention for its potent psychoactive effects and complex terpene profile. The strain was developed by breeders seeking to create a cultivar with strong cerebral effects balanced by physical relaxation. While its exact origins are somewhat obscure in the cannabis community, Psy-Op is generally understood to be a carefully selected hybrid that combines genetics from notable parent strains to produce its distinctive characteristics. The name 'Psy-Op' (short for psychological operation) references the strain's reputation for producing intense, mind-altering effects that some users describe as mentally immersive or thought-provoking.

Visually, Psy-Op typically produces dense, resinous buds with a structure that leans slightly toward the indica side of its hybrid heritage. The flowers often display deep green coloration with occasional purple hues that become more pronounced under cooler growing conditions. A thick coating of trichomes gives the buds a frosty appearance, while orange or amber pistils provide visual contrast. The strain's aroma profile is complex, combining earthy base notes with brighter citrus and pine accents that become more pronounced when the buds are broken apart or ground.

Psy-Op has developed a reputation among experienced cannabis consumers for its balanced yet potent effects that begin with cerebral stimulation before transitioning to full-body relaxation. The strain's effects are often described as coming in distinct phases, with an initial uplifting mental buzz that gradually gives way to more sedative physical sensations. This progression makes Psy-Op suitable for evening use for many consumers. The strain's potency means it may be overwhelming for novice users or those with low tolerance, and responsible consumption practices are recommended.

Psy-Op Strain Growing Information

Psy-Op is considered a moderate-difficulty strain to cultivate, requiring some experience to achieve optimal results. The plants typically flower in 8-10 weeks indoors, with outdoor harvests occurring in mid to late October in northern hemisphere climates. Indoor yields are generally good, producing approximately 400-500 grams per square meter under optimal conditions, while outdoor plants can yield 500-600 grams per plant. The strain adapts well to both indoor and outdoor growing environments but prefers a controlled indoor setting where temperature and humidity can be carefully managed. Plants tend to remain medium in height, making them suitable for spaces with vertical limitations. Special considerations include maintaining proper airflow to prevent mold in the dense buds and providing adequate support during flowering as the resinous buds can become heavy. Some phenotypes may benefit from cooler nighttime temperatures to enhance purple coloration.
